A. Identify Business Needs

Before diving into the world of cloud services, it’s essential to assess your current IT infrastructure and processes to understand where improvements can be made. Determine your business goals and objectives to align your cloud strategy with your overall vision. Identify specific areas where cloud services can enhance your operations, such as data storage, scalability, or application hosting.

B. Cloud Readiness Check

Conduct a thorough evaluation of your network connectivity and security requirements to ensure a smooth transition to the cloud. Assess your data migration and integration capabilities to minimize disruptions during the migration process. Determine the training and support needs of your staff to facilitate a seamless adoption of cloud technologies.

C. Cloud Service Provider Selection

Research and compare different cloud providers to find the one that best fits your business requirements. Consider factors such as price, scalability, security, and customer support when evaluating providers. Request demos and references from potential providers to ensure that they can meet your specific needs.

Implementation

Once you have completed the planning and assessment phase, it’s time to move on to the implementation of cloud services in your business.

A. Cloud Infrastructure Provisioning

Decide on the appropriate cloud deployment model (public, private, or hybrid) based on your business needs and security requirements. Configure virtual machines, storage, networking, and security services according to your specifications. Integrate your cloud infrastructure with existing on-premises systems for seamless operations.

B. Data Migration

Develop a comprehensive data migration strategy to transfer your data to the cloud securely and efficiently. Choose suitable data migration tools and techniques to minimize downtime and data loss. C. Application Modernization

Identify the applications in your organization that are suitable for migration to the cloud. Optimize these applications for better performance in the cloud environment. Consider re-architecting applications to leverage cloud-native functionalities and improve efficiency.

D. Security Configuration

Implement robust security measures to protect your data and applications in the cloud. Configure firewalls, access control policies, and encryption protocols to safeguard your assets. Adhere to industry best practices and compliance requirements to maintain a secure cloud environment.

After the initial implementation phase, focus on optimizing your cloud services to ensure maximum efficiency and cost-effectiveness.

A. Performance Monitoring

Utilize cloud monitoring tools to track performance metrics and identify any bottlenecks in your infrastructure. Address performance issues promptly to maintain optimal service levels. Optimize resource allocation and usage to improve overall performance.

B. Cost Management

Implement cloud cost monitoring and optimization tools to track and manage your cloud expenses. Understand different cloud pricing models and usage patterns to optimize costs. Identify cost-saving strategies such as resource scheduling and rightsizing to reduce your cloud expenditure.

C. Continuous Improvement

Continuously review and adjust your cloud implementation strategy to align with your evolving business needs. Explore new cloud services and technologies to stay competitive in the market. Seek feedback from stakeholders and iterate on improvements to enhance your cloud operations continually.

Best Practices

Adhering to best practices is essential for maintaining a secure and efficient cloud environment for your business.

A. Governance and Compliance

Establish clear cloud governance policies to regulate the use of cloud services within your organization. Ensure compliance with relevant regulations and industry standards to mitigate risks. Foster accountability and transparency in your cloud operations to maintain trust with your stakeholders.

B. Security and Data Protection

Prioritize security throughout the cloud lifecycle to protect your sensitive data and applications. Implement measures such as multi-factor authentication and encryption to safeguard your assets. Regularly test your security protocols to identify and address vulnerabilities proactively.

C. Training and Support

Invest in training programs to educate your staff on cloud principles and best practices. Provide ongoing support and resources for cloud users to enhance their skills and proficiency. Frequently Asked Questions

What are the benefits of implementing cloud services in my business?

Implementing cloud services can lead to cost savings, improved scalability, enhanced data security, increased collaboration among employees, and easier access to data from anywhere.

How can I choose the right cloud service provider for my business?

What factors should I consider before migrating my business to the cloud?

Before migrating to the cloud, consider factors such as data security, compliance regulations, budget constraints, available resources for managing the transition, and potential impacts on your existing workflows.

How can I ensure a smooth transition when implementing cloud services in my business?

To ensure a smooth transition, create a detailed implementation plan, involve key stakeholders from different departments, provide training for employees, regularly communicate updates, and perform thorough testing before fully migrating to the cloud.

What are some common challenges businesses face when implementing cloud services?

Some common challenges include data security concerns, potential downtime during the migration process, resistance from employees to adapt to new technology, integration issues with existing software, and 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ements.
